What Vermont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in business development representative jobs across Vermont.

  • Bachelor's degree in business, marketing, communications, or a related field preferred by Vermont employers
  • Proven ability to prospect and qualify leads through cold outreach, email, and phone
  • Familiarity with CRM platforms such as Salesforce or HubSpot for pipeline management
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ills for engaging Vermont-based business decision makers
  • Experience meeting or exceeding outbound call and meeting quotas in a sales environment
  • Ability to collaborate with account executives and marketing teams in a fast-paced setting

How do you become a business development representative in Vermont?

Business development representative roles in Vermont require no state-issued license or certification, so the path is education and experience based. Most Vermont employers expect a b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field, though some accept equivalent sales experience. Candidates who complete recognized sales development training programs or earn certifications through organizations like HubSpot or Salesforce tend to stand out in a competitive Burlington-area market.

How much do business development representatives make in Vermont?

Business development representatives in Vermont earn a median of about $77,530 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$47,290 for the lowest 10% to over $148,470 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Are there remote business development representative jobs in Vermont?

Yes, and more than most fields. Business development representative work is desk-based and phone or video driven, making it well suited to remote arrangements. About 36% of business development representative openings tied to Vermont are remote or hybrid as of July 2026, reflecting broader tech and SaaS employer flexibility. Fully remote roles are most common in SaaS and fintech companies that maintain a Vermont presence but recruit statewide.

How can I get hired as a business development representative in Vermont with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is applying to sales development representative or inside sales associate roles at Vermont's technology and financial services companies, which regularly bring on candidates without direct business development experience. Employers like National Life Group and Burlington-area SaaS firms run structured onboarding programs for new hires. Candidates who earn a HubSpot Sales or Salesforce Administrator certification, or who have experience in customer service or retail, consistently move into business development representative roles at these organizations.
